嫩草院一区二区乱码问题解析:5个步骤快速修复访问异常
嫩草院一区二区乱码问题解析:5个步骤快速修复访问异常
在使用嫩草院一区二区等网站时,用户经常会遇到页面显示乱码的问题。这种情况不仅影响阅读体验,还可能导致功能异常。乱码通常表现为页面显示为问号、方块或无法识别的字符,这背后往往涉及编码设置、网络传输或服务器配置等多个因素。
乱码问题的根本原因分析
嫩草院一区二区出现乱码的主要原因包括:字符编码不匹配、服务器配置错误、浏览器缓存问题、网络传输数据损坏以及网站程序编码缺陷。其中,UTF-8与GB2312等编码标准的不兼容是最常见的诱因。当服务器发送的编码信息与浏览器解析方式不一致时,就会导致页面显示异常。
5个步骤快速修复访问异常
第一步:检查并修正浏览器编码设置
在浏览器中右键点击页面,选择"编码"或"字符编码",确保选择"自动检测"或明确设置为UTF-8。如果问题仍然存在,可以尝试清除浏览器缓存和Cookie,然后重新加载页面。对于Chrome用户,可以通过开发者工具(F12)的Network标签检查响应头中的Content-Type字段,确认字符编码信息。
第二步:验证网站服务器配置
服务器端的配置错误是导致嫩草院一区二区乱码的重要原因。检查服务器的HTTP响应头,确保Content-Type包含正确的charset参数,如"Content-Type: text/html; charset=utf-8"。对于Apache服务器,可以通过.htaccess文件添加"AddDefaultCharset UTF-8"指令;Nginx服务器则需要在配置文件中设置"charset utf-8"。
第三步:检查数据库连接编码
如果嫩草院一区二区网站使用数据库存储内容,需要确认数据库连接的字符集设置。在MySQL中,执行"SET NAMES 'utf8'"命令,或在连接字符串中指定字符集。同时检查数据库、表和字段的字符集设置,确保统一使用UTF-8编码,避免数据存储和读取过程中的编码转换问题。
第四步:修复网页源代码编码声明
在HTML文档的<head>部分,必须包含正确的meta标签声明:<meta charset="UTF-8">。同时检查文件本身的保存编码,确保源代码文件以UTF-8无BOM格式保存。对于动态网页,还需要在输出前设置正确的HTTP头,如PHP中的"header('Content-Type: text/html; charset=utf-8')"。
第五步:排查网络传输过程中的数据损坏
某些情况下,嫩草院一区二区的乱码问题可能源于网络传输过程中的数据包损坏或中间代理服务器的错误处理。使用抓包工具如Wireshark分析HTTP请求和响应,检查是否有数据篡改。如果使用CDN服务,检查CDN配置是否正确传递了编码信息,必要时联系服务提供商协助排查。
预防乱码问题的最佳实践
为彻底解决嫩草院一区二区的乱码问题,建议采取系统化的预防措施:建立统一的UTF-8编码标准并贯穿于整个开发流程;在数据库设计、服务器配置和前端代码中保持编码一致性;定期进行编码兼容性测试;部署监控系统及时发现编码异常。这些措施能有效避免乱码问题的反复发生。
总结
嫩草院一区二区乱码问题虽然常见,但通过以上五个步骤的系统排查和修复,大多数情况下都能快速解决。从浏览器设置到服务器配置,从数据库连接到网络传输,每个环节都需要仔细检查。保持全栈编码的一致性,是预防和解决乱码问题的关键所在。遵循这些专业建议,用户将能够顺畅访问嫩草院一区二区,享受更好的使用体验。